  1. American Flamingos (Phoenicopterus ruber) congregating in shallow areas of the lagoon in Ría Celestún, one of their main resting and feeding habitats in the Yucatan Peninsula. Boats approach the flamingos to a certain extent in order not to scare them away.
    A colony of Magnificent frigatebirds Fregata magnificens on the red mangrove forests (Rhizophora mangle).
    Inside the Red Mangrove Forests. The lagoon itself acquires the red colors given by the mangrove tannins.
    An island of high rise forests (Peten) amidst the mangrove, due to the presence of a freshwater spring typically called "ojo de agua".
